## Releases

The Crumbleton order system enforces a hard cutoff: custom cake orders placed after 2 p.m. are scheduled for the day after next, no exceptions. This rule ships as part of each storefront release and cannot be toggled per location. Support should not promise overrides; escalate edge cases to the bakery operations channel instead. Release bundles for the cutoff module are versioned monthly and must be verified before installation. The signing key used to validate each release bundle appears below.

rollout seal: bky9_PeXH1fTLY

// COLD_START_WARM_POOL_SIZE for the Brindlehop invoice handlers.
// Three pre-warmed instances cover p99 morning traffic in the Kesmere
// region; fewer than that reintroduces 1.8s cold starts after deploys.
// Cost impact is negligible at current volume. Validated during the
// last load test, whose identifying token is recorded below.
const COLD_START_WARM_POOL_SIZE = 3;

pipeline stamp: htk3_cc5

## Changelog — v4.2.0: Deep-Link Routing Defaults

Routemark now resolves mobile deep links through the Lanthorn resolver by default instead of the legacy path matcher. Unmatched links fall back to the app home screen rather than an error interstitial, and the resolver cache TTL has been shortened so stale mappings clear faster during incidents. On-call engineers should note that the kill switch for the new resolver moved into the routing config block, not the feature-flag service. The shipped defaults for this release are as follows.

deployment values, kajep-kageg:
[praix]
host = praix.paliqcorp.corp
user = praix_svc
database = praix_prod

Handover — Marla to Jeff. Uniform crates for the new Torvik Lane depot are packed: 14 boxes, sized and labelled per the Fennick Apparel manifest. Sign-off sheet is in crate 1. Driver expected Thursday morning. Do not split the load. The courier hand-over instruction for this run is as follows.

courier memo of fahag-badug: the norys istion courier leaves the zoriel ledger at gate 4000 under passcode 457370